Compartmentalized polymerization initiated by oil-soluble initiators. Calculation of average number of radicals per particle
Authors:Preben C Mrk  John Ugelstad  Jan Ole Aasen
Institution:Preben C. Mørk,John Ugelstad,Jan Ole Aasen
Abstract:Expressions for calculating the stationary state distribution of radicals in compartmentalized systems with a constant number of reaction loci containing an oil-soluble initiator are given. Besides pairwise formation of radicals in the particles, desorption and reabsorption, water phase termination, solubility of the initiator in the aqueous phase, and the possibility of formation of a single radical species are taken into consideration. The calculation is based on a probabilistic analysis leading to a third-order recurrence relation solved using confluent, hypergeometric Kummer functions. Some calculated curves illustrating the de-pendence of the average number of radicals per particle on various relevant parameters are included. © 1995 John Wiley & Sons, Inc.
